How much do manager coax j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 22, 2026, the average yearly pay for manager coax in the United States is $81,677.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$50,000.00 and $116,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Manager Coax vs Network Manager?

AspectManager CoaxNetwork Manager
CredentialsTypically requires a technical background in coaxial cable systems, certifications in cable installation or maintenanceRequires networking certifications (e.g., Cisco CCNA), IT or telecommunications background
Work EnvironmentFieldwork involving installation, maintenance, and troubleshooting of coaxial cable systemsOffice and technical environments managing network infrastructure and configurations
Industry UsageCommon in cable TV, telecommunications, and broadband service providersPrevalent in IT, telecommunications, and enterprise network management

While both roles involve technical expertise in communication systems, Manager Coax focuses on coaxial cable infrastructure, whereas Network Manager oversees broader network systems and configurations. The choice depends on whether the job emphasizes physical cable systems or network management and IT infrastructure.

Position Overview

As a Coax Installation & Repair Technician, you will install, repair, and maintain coaxial cable systems for residential and commercial customers in the Columbus and Cleveland, OH areas. This hands-on role is ideal for technicians who take pride in their workmanship, value safety and accuracy, and want to grow within the broadband and telecommunications industry.


Key Responsibilities

  • Perform residential installations and repairs for video, internet, and phone services
  • Troubleshoot and repair coax systems using appropriate signal meters and diagnostic tools
  • Follow all safety protocols and procedures to ensure compliance and job site safety
  • Collaborate with team members and supervisors to meet daily service goals
  • Represent Triage Partners professionally with customers, providing excellent service and communication
  • Work in various weather conditions and at heights as required
  • Use job management systems and mobile applications to document completed work accurately

What You'll Need

  • Your own Viavi 620 meter (or similar) - required
  • Local to the Columbus, OH area - required
  • Your own truck or van (required)
  • Valid driver's license, vehicle registration, and insurance
  • Ability to work safely, efficiently, and to industry standards
  • Flexible availability to meet changing project schedules
  • Strong communication and customer service skills
  • Comfortable working at heights and in indoor/outdoor environments
  • Basic computer proficiency
